Are you wondering how to setup a blog when actually you don’t know anything in programming language, not even html basic, you might be wondering, Is it possible to build a blog?
in these tutorials, I will teach you how to setup a blog in less than 5 minutes without knowing a line of code and I’ll also show you how to monetize it.
When you are you are done with these tutorials, you should be able to how to set up a blog but if there is anything that is unclear to you, you are welcome to ask questions or contact me privately. I will be delighted to help you, this guide contain pictures for proper understanding.
I know that blogging seems overwhelming for beginners, that’s why this post was created for beginners, you don’t need to be a professional programmer with high-tech skills to develop a beautiful full functional blog, even if you are rated 10/100, you will be able to create your own blog with the steps below:
How to start a blog
- Choose an attractive domain name
- Choose a hosting provider
- Install WordPress
- Customise your blog
- Write your first blog post
- Monetize your blog
what is blogging?
A blog is a website that place priority on your content, it is a content focused type of sites where the writer who is the blogger provides informative content to the visitors. To learn more about a blog, click here and I also have a beautiful on blogging mistakes you should avoid.
Why you should start blogging?
There are many reasons you should start blogging especially if you have something of great interest to you, a passion or alternative source of income.
Here is a simple mathematics passion+interest+business=money. What ever reason you have, it will finally payoff.
A blog gives you the freedom to express yourself to the world and connect with people who shares the same interest with you and it can be a great source of income when done the right way.
You choose the tone you discuss with your audience but most blogger’s choose the informal format.
You are entitled to write anything that is of great interest to you, after all it’s your space.
What defines you as a true blogger is the ability to learn over time and solves your audience problems, your articles should be informative, educative and entertaining at the same time.
You don’t need a degree in your choosen niche to start blogging,as long as you have interest on your choosen niche, you will find it interesting to learn more and more along the long run.
Is blogging still profitable in 2022?
Seeing the numbers of blog springing up on daily basis, there is a blog on any niche imaginable, beginners are faced with the question, is blogging still profitable? Isn’t it too late to start blogging?.
Yes and yes, blogging is profitable and will continue to be profitable as long as you are using the right technique’s. To be a successful blogger, you need to choose a niche that is focused on helping your visitors achieve something, it will differentiate you blog from other blog’s and unique (Note that what makes your website unique is the quality of content that you provide).
It will protect you from the competitive environment, from other established blog’s since your blog is focused on helping a single audience.
Reason. Why you should start a blog
- To share your knowledge, stories, interest and passion to the world.
- To create an alternative means of income.
- Blogging gives you awareness, recognition and make you an expert that others will look up to for advice.
- Connect you will people who shares the same interest and passion with you.
- Blogging helps boost brand awareness if you have a business.
Choose an attractive domain name
One of the most important first move you will make is to choose a domain name, not just any works, your domain name should give your audience a tip of what your blog is all about without visiting your site.
There are couple of things to consider while choosing a domain name for your blog:
Your niche
The niche you choose to blog on determines your blog name for instance it doesn’t make sense to have a blog on political niche and your keyword have something like recipes in your domain name or a marketing blog with mobile gadgets keyword in it’s domain.
It’s a misconception, don’t drive away potential traffic by choosing a complicated domain.
Keep it simple, memorable with keywords relating to your niche but if your blog is all about you, I humbly advice you to use your own name if it is still available. Try other domain extensions with your choosen domain to see if it is available, for example, supertechcity.com is already taken but you can still try supertechcity.org or supertechcity.net to see which is available, hello it’s just an example, not asking you to do that, come up with something unique and brandable.
Remember whatever name you choose will become your blog URL but don’t worry, you can still change it later.
If you are having a hard time coming up with a perfect domain name, please contact me, I will help you brainstorm some amazing domain name ideas for free,I owe you that.
Choose a webhosting provider
After you are done choosing a domain name which I believe you have, the next stage Is to choose a webhosting company for your blog, see our list of best webhosting companies.
While WordPress itself is free, you need a webhosting company to make your website visible and accessible to the world wide web audience. For webhosting, I recommend bluehost, they’re WordPress number one recommendation and see reasons:
- They are affordable
- Get free domain
- Free CDN+SSL
- 24/7/365 customer support
- 1 click WordPress installation
- Fast performance
- Money back guarantee
- Reliability
Then for new blogger’s especially in Nigeria who can’t afford or choose to patronize a local hosting company, there are couple of great and reliable webhosting companies I have tested and best so far is domainking.ng👑, they are affordable, reliable, there customer service is outstanding and you stand a chance to get free domain+SSL when you host your website with them.
Take it from me, they are the best in Nigeria.
For the sake of these tutorials, I am using domain king for experiment however, not minding the webhosting company you choose,it is still the same step.
First choose a hosting plan
2. Go ahead to pay for your choosen plan
On the new window, if you have already registered a domain name, then choose I will use my existing domain and update your nameserver but if you don’t have a domain name, type your domain name and click on check, if it’s available hurry, scroll down the page and click on continue.
On the next page, cross check your details, you see a summary of your orders before clicking on continue
You would be directed to a checkout page to complete your purchase, click on checkout
At these stage, if you have an account, just accept there terms and conditions and click on complete order but if you don’t have an account, just create one and complete order.
When your order is complete, check your email for your cpanel details.
How to access your WordPress cpanel and login?
- To access your WordPress cpanel, put cpanel at the end of your domain for example, yourdomain.com/cpanel.
- you would be prompted to your login page, input your login details to login.
How to install WordPress
To install WordPress on your domain from your cpanel:
Open your cpanel
Scroll down and choose software by softaculous
Click on install WordPress
Fill out all the necessary details
When you are done, click on install below the page
You have successfully install WordPress on your domain, hurry and visit your website.
How to login to your WordPress admin dashboard?
You are done with your WordPress installation and now you are wondering how to access your WordPress backend of your blog, this guide is simple, just keep reading.
Add wp-admin to the end of your website, for example, supertechcity.com/wp-admin
On the next page, enter your WordPress installation username and password.
If you loose your password, don’t panic, click on lost password to recover it
You will be redirected to your WordPress admin backend.
How to install a WordPress theme?
WordPress install a default theme for your blog automatically, if the default theme doesn’t meet your requirement, don’t worry but before then, see our list of WordPress themes, it will help you make a choice.
There are thousands of free and premium WordPress themes available that serves different purpose based on your requirement, to access WordPress free theme directory, click on appearance
The good thing about WordPress is that it’s easy to change the appearance of your website in minutes without knowing a line of code, from the list of available themes, choose the one you want based on your requirement.
Click on install and activate
That’s it, you have successfully installed a WordPress theme on your blog.
Not satisfied with the default design, want something professional, let’s customize your theme.
How to customize a WordPress theme (easy steps)
Go to appearance, click on customize
On the next page, you have the power to edit and make changes to your theme.
What is a WordPress plugin?
A WordPress plugin is a software designed to add extra features and functionalities to your website.
WordPress plugin extend the existing features of your website, WordPress is the home of thousands of free and premium WordPress plugins. It has a plugin for any features you want, It allows you to create any type of website that you want, for example, you can use a WordPress plugin to add social share button to your blog, build e-commerce website, build form’s, email list and many others.
How to install a WordPress plugin?
To install a WordPress plugin, just follow the steps below:
Click on plugin
Click on add new
Choose or search plugin
Click on install and wait, next click on activate
You just added a new features/functionalities to your website.
How to write a blog post on WordPress?
Ready to write your first blog post, you are just few steps away from being a blogger, ready to share your interest to the world, let’s get started;
From your admin menu bar, click on post
Click on add new
On the next page, enter your title and content
When you are done,hit the publish button to publish.
You have just created your first blog post.
Now, there are questions that should be popping up on your mind, how often should I post? How to increase website traffic? and many more, don’t panic, I will treat each and every one of them.
How often should I post on my blog?
How often you post on your blog entirely depends on you the blogger, how long it takes you to prepare an article.
It’s your blog anyways, you can post whenever you want as long as the article Is ready but the secret is be consistent, create an editorial calendar and stick to it, I have a post on blogging mistakes and how to fix them, you can check it out.
Which site can I use to drive traffic to my blog
Social media Is a great tool to drive traffic to your blog, I use social media and forums, some site I recommend are:
- Niche Facebook groups
- Quora
- If you have lots of graphics, Pinterest is a good choice.
You can also niche it down further, choose a community that oversees the interest of your audience.
Proven ways to increase website traffic?
- Send newsletter
- Do keyword research, include your keywords in your content
- Stay active on social media
- Run advertisement
- Do guess post
- Create high quality contents
How and way’s to monetize your blog?
There are number of ways to monetize your blog. They are as follows:
- Ad network
- Affiliate marketing
- Creating course
- Ebook sale’s
- Digital download
- Direct advertising
- Sponsorship post etc
How to summit your blog to search engine?
After creating your blog, you want it to appear in search engine then you have to summit it to search engine like Google, Bing, yahoo etc.
To do that, visit Google console page,add your website to your web property
Click on add property to add your website.
How to verify your domain on Google?
To verify your domain on Google, first you have to add your website to your property on Google console.
Click on setting
Click on ownership verification
Choose any method for verification, HTML tag, Google analytics, Google tag manager, domain name provider etc
Follow up the procedure as stipulated.
How to summit your sitemap to Google?
To summit a sitemap to Google in WordPress, you need your SEO plugin to generate it for you automatically. For the sake of these tutorials,we are using rankmath, click on rankmath> sitemap
copy your sitemap Link and. Open your Google console, click on sitemap
Click on add new sitemap
Paste the link and click on continue
NOTE: your sitemap must be in XML format.
What is a sitemap?
A sitemap is a file that gives search engine detail explanation of everything on your website and their relationship. A sitemap tells which page of your website are more important and valuable.
Why you need a sitemap?
A sitemap helps search engines like Google crawl your site property,if you link your webpages properly, it helps search engine discover valuable information about your website and speed up crawling.
According to Google, using sitemap doesn’t guarantee that every page on your sitemap will be crawled and indexed,as Google rely on complex algorithm to schedule crawling. Your website can benefit also from having a sitemap and if you don’t have, your website will not suffer or be penalized.
Back to the question, you have to weight the pros and cons to make your decision, for me, you should have a sitemap.
Reason why you might need a sitemap?
- You need a sitemap if your website is big, Google might overlook some important and valuable information on your site like new and recent updates.
- You need a sitemap if your website is new and have fewer external like pointing to it, Google bot and other web crawlers crawl web according to some stipulated standards that Google discover discover link’s from one page to another. You are at risk of Google not discovery your website if no other site link’s to them.
- You need a sitemap If your website has lots of video and image or shown in Google news, sitemap helps search engines take additional information about your site and provide them when necessary.
- You need a sitemap if your content pages are not properly linked to one another, your sitemap helps make sure that Google doesn’t overlook any of your pages.
Reason why you might not need a sitemap?
You don’t need a sitemap if your website is:
- Small
- Properly linked internally
- Don’t have Rich media files or new pages
What is backlink?
A backlink is a link from other website pointing to the resources on your website. If someone mention your website in there own website, a backlink is automatically generated.
Search engines like Google rank and weight website according to the numbers of backlink from authority website to determine that the site is trust worthy and have lots of resourceful content.
How do bloggers get paid?
You can earn money through ad network, affiliate marketing, sponsorship post,direct advertising, course, ebook, download, selling your product and service etc
Is it free to start a blog?
No! You need to buy a domain name and a hosting provider to get started, WordPress is free.
How do I start my own blog at home?
All you need to start your own blog from home is buy a domain name, choose your niche, get a webhosting provider to host your website and install WordPress, that’s it!
Thanks for reading these article,if it was helpful, please share with others,I would love to hear what you think of these article, was it helpful? Don’t forget to follow me on Facebook Twitter and Instagram,big thanks.